WordPress.com MCP prompt examples

Not sure what to do with your new WordPress.com MCP tools? Here are some example prompts to get you started.

Getting Started

  • “Which of my sites gets the most traffic?”
  • “Find all my sites with custom domains.”

Site Configuration

  • “Check the comment settings on my portfolio site.”
  • “Is user registration enabled on my community site?”

User Management

  • “Who are the administrators on my company blog?”
  • “List all editors on example.com.”
  • “Find users who haven’t logged in recently on my site”

Plugin Management

  • “What plugins are installed on my main site?”
  • “What plugins are currently active on my store?”

Post Searching

  • “Find all my posts about artificial intelligence.”
  • “Show me posts I published last month.”
  • “List my scheduled posts across all sites.”
  • “Find posts by author John on my company blog.”

Specific Post Retrieval

  • “Retrieve my latest published post with its comments.”
  • “Get the about page from my portfolio site.”

Comment Management

  • “Show me pending comments on my blog.”
  • “Find all comments from the last week.”
  • “Search for comments mentioning ‘excellent.'”

Multi-Site Searches

  • “Search for posts about ‘WordPress tips’ across all my sites”
  • “Show me posts I’ve published today across all sites”
  • “Find pages about ‘contact’ on all my websites.”

Comparative Analysis

  • “Which of my sites has the most published posts?”
  • “Show me sites that haven’t been updated recently.”
  • “Show me which posts are generating the most discussion.”

Content Analysis

  • “Find all posts in the ‘Technology’ category.”
  • “Show me posts modified in the last 3 days.”

User Activity

  • “Show me authors who posted this week.”
  • “Who are my most productive authors and what are they writing about?”
  • “Search for inactive editors on my team blog.”

Site Monitoring

  • “Check which sites have pending comments.”
  • “Find archived or suspended sites in my account.”

Content Auditing

  • “Create a report of all draft posts older than 30 days.”
  • “Find duplicate post titles across my sites.”
  • “List all posts without categories.”
  • “Show me posts that haven’t been updated in a year.”

Maintenance Tasks

  • “Find all spam comments across my sites for cleanup.”
  • “List plugins that are inactive but still installed.”
  • “Show me sites that need attention (updates, comments, etc).”
  • “Check for posts stuck in pending status.”
  • “Give me a complete health report for example.com.”

Research & Discovery

  • “Find all posts mentioning a competitor’s name.”
  • “Search for content about emerging trends on my blogs.”
  • “List all posts with videos or attachments.”
  • “Find all content about AI across my sites and show me which needs updating.”
  • “Find my most popular draft posts that deserve to be published.”
  • “Compare my tech blog with my personal blog.”
